NFL total We played Minn/Pitt over 45. I made the number 47.5 on this contest.Pittsburgh can officially be called a passing team. Roethlisberger leads the NFL with 1887 passing yards and Hines Ward leads receivers with 599 receiving yards. The Steelers will be going against the 24th ranked pass defense. Minny has given up an average of 355 passing yards in their last 3 games. In addition, the Vikings' best db,Antoine Winfield, has not been able to practice because of a foot injury.The Steelers have played 4 consecutive"overs" and are 5-0 "over" when they play against a good team ( operationally defined as having a winning percentage of .667 or better).In the last 60 Pittsburgh home games, the "over" has cashed 42 times. Minnesota will going against a Steelers' defense minus one of their best D-linemen, Aaron Smith. In addition, all-pro safety,Polamalu, has been held out of some practices this week. Even though I expect him to play, he is still not at 100%.The Vikings are 25-11 "over" when they play on the road versus a team with a winning record.In addition, they are 15-8 "over" on the road after allowing 28+ points in their last game.The Vikings are currently the second highest scoring team in the NFL (31.5 ppg).They have played 4 consecutive "overs" and are 5-1 "over" for the season.When installed as a road dog, the "over" has cashed in 7 of their last 8 games in this role.The Vikings are also 7-1 "over" when playing on grass.After passing for over 250 yds in their last game, the over has now cashed 9 consecutive times in Minnesota matchups. As of today, the current weather forecast for Sunday's contest is temps in the high 40's, an 11% chance of rain and winds of 5 mph. Good luck, charliej
